    Perhaps not as obscure as others but Mandalore is still a favorite of mine. For a little more obscure I also was fond of Yinchorr for its role in the training of the Imperial royal guard (Crimson Empire is awesome btw). In Crimson Empire it just seemed so desolate. At first with its desolation its kind of silly that a bunch of guys in pastel colors are trying to kill each other to hang out with Palpatine, but when Carnor Jax and Kir Kanos stand in the squall in uniform to kill one another its beautiful. A planet of nothing but two guys fighting for loyalty to a space wizard is one of those weird concepts that I adore about Star Wars.
